H-beam
H-beam is a new type of economic construction steel. H-section steel cross-section shape is economical and reasonable, good mechanical properties, rolling cross-section of the points on the extension of more uniform, small internal stress, compared with
ordinary I-beam, with a large cross-section modulus, light weight, save the advantages of metal, Structure to reduce 30-40%; and because of its legs inside and outside the parallel, leg is a right angle, assembled into a component, can save welding, riveting workload of 25%.



I-beam
I-beam, also known as steel beam, is a long steel strip shaped like an I-beam. I-beams, ordinary I-beams, and lightweight I-beams. It is a steel cross-section shaped like an I-beam. I steel is widely used in construction and other metal structures. I-beams are used for heavy support, angle irons are used for small support or forming, square tubes are used for various doors, windows, decorations, etc., and large square tubes can also be used for other purposes. In structural design, the selection of I-beams should be based on their mechanical properties, chemical properties, weldability, structural dimensions, etc

FAQ


1.Q:What is a forged shaft?
A:Forged steel shafts are created through a manufacturing process that involves the shaping of the
shaft Forgings using localized compressive forces.

2.Q:What are the advantages of forged shafts?
A:Forging shafts can improve the metal's organizational structure and mechanical properties, ensuring that the parts have good mechanical properties and a longer service life.

3.Q:Material selection for forged shafts?
A:The materials used for forging shafts are mainly carbon steel and alloy steel of various compositions, followed by aluminum, magnesium, copper, titanium and their alloys.

4.Q:What are the process flows for forging shafts?
A:Taking hot die forging as an example, the general sequence is: blanking, heating, roll forging, die forging, trimming, punching, correction, intermediate inspection, heat treatment of forgings, cleaning, correction and inspection.

5.Q:What are the classifications of forging temperatures?
A:According to the different forging temperatures, it can be divided into hot forging (above 800℃), warm forging or semi-hot forging (between 300-800℃) and cold forging (performed at room temperature).
